Angry Rear door window replacement for a 2006 XC 90 Left-hand drive 2006

Rear door window replacement for a 2006 XC 90 Left-hand drive 2006

Hi out there. Does anyone know how to fit a new rear door replacement electric window glass? I have removed the door
panel and the broken glass from the aluminium support on the regulator, but I cannot understand how the new glass fits in the door. opening it looks too big. Can anyone help?

You have to take the small fixed window out to make room to get the sliding glass in (or out if it's in one piece!)

Default Managed to remove the fixed teat door quarter window

Originally Posted by Tops1966
I am having difficulty removing the fixed quarter window, I have removed the the top screw and the bottom bolt , but I cannot move the quarter window to the left , do I need to remove the top guide seal or any of the exterior mouldings ?
Great news after much effort,I managed to remove the quarter window. It helps if you remove the shiny black exterior trim and use a screwdriver to lever the wind from the bottom first whilst holding the interior bottom rubber up at the same time. Then once you have moved it a few times push from the top and rubber finally releases. Remember to pull the rubber seal first at the top of the window aperture..
